Transaction 5106e41c74d37baff50ec08cea74e9a19409bb708b8c8f9fe6f5deae123ddda7

2 Input
2 Outputs
  • 5106e41c74d37baff50ec08cea74e9a19409bb708b8c8f9fe6f5deae123ddda7:0
  • value  10000000
    address  34vfowFf1zGCEc5m6BhR9WkSVexqQRARff
  • 5106e41c74d37baff50ec08cea74e9a19409bb708b8c8f9fe6f5deae123ddda7:1
  • value  10405885
    address  3BMEXpbdyez2wmVPmPNzTcj7AQMiZdtRLm